How to Make the Perfect Indian Salad with Seasonal Ingredients
Indian salads are a delightful blend of fresh, colorful vegetables and aromatic spices, perfect for complementing any meal or serving as a light snack. Making the perfect Indian salad with seasonal ingredients enhances flavors and maximizes nutrition. Here is a simple guide to crafting a vibrant and tasty Indian salad.
1. Choose Seasonal Ingredients
To create the perfect Indian salad, focus on using seasonal vegetables. Depending on the time of year, consider ingredients such as:
- Spring: Cucumbers, radishes, carrots, and leafy greens.
- Summer: Tomatoes, bell peppers, avocados, and corn.
- Autumn: Beets, pumpkin, kale, and apples.
- Winter: Spinach, fenugreek leaves, carrots, and purple cabbage.
2. Select Your Base
The base of your salad can greatly influence its flavor and texture. Choose from:
- Leafy Greens: Spinach, arugula, or lettuce work beautifully as a base.
- Whole Grains: Quinoa or brown rice can add heartiness to the salad.
- Legumes: Chickpeas or black beans provide protein and additional flavor.
3. Add Fresh Vegetables
Incorporate a variety of fresh vegetables to enhance the colors and nutrients in your salad. Some great options include:
- Diced tomatoes for juiciness
- Chopped cucumbers for crunch
- Sliced bell peppers for sweetness
- Grated carrots for a touch of earthiness
4. Add a Protein Source
To make your salad more filling, include a healthy protein source. Good options are:
- Paneer cubes, for a creamy texture
- Boiled eggs, for richness
- Roasted chickpeas, for crunch and flavor
5. Spice it Up
Indian salads wouldn’t be complete without a blend of spices. Some popular seasonings include:
- Cumin: Adds an earthy flavor.
- Chaat Masala: Provides a tangy kick.
- Black salt: Enhances the overall taste with a unique flavor.
6. Prepare a Zesty Dressing
A good dressing can tie all the elements of your salad together. Try this simple Indian dressing:
- Mix 2 tablespoons of olive oil with 1 tablespoon of lemon juice.
- Add 1 teaspoon of honey or jaggery for sweetness.
- Sprinkle in salt, pepper, and a pinch of red chili powder for heat.
7. Combine and Serve
Finally, combine all your ingredients in a large bowl. Toss gently to ensure that everything is coated with the dressing and spices. Serve immediately for the freshest taste. Garnish with fresh coriander or mint leaves for an added pop of flavor.
8. Customize Your Salad
Don't hesitate to customize your Indian salad according to your taste preferences. Add seasonal fruits like pomegranate seeds, mangoes, or oranges for sweetness and a touch of tropical flair. You can also include nuts like peanuts or almonds for a delightful crunch.
